Phoenix - Functional expansion of PLCnext controllers with a left-side safety module


An efficient solution for distributed safety applications


The AXC F XT SPLC 1000 - SPLC 1000 for short - has been developed as a dedicated safety controller that is primarily used in a distributed safety system. The new module uses the black channel principle to communicate with other Profisafe devices. This safety controller can be seamlessly integrated into the PLCnext-Technology open ecosystem. 
 

Use to the highest safety level

The SPLC 1000 is a full-fledged safety controller that meets the highest safety level (SIL 3 and PL e respectively). The SPLC contains two separate and distinct processors based on the ARM Cortex M4 architecture. The SPLC 1000 is ideally suited for the implementation of smaller distributed applications. The SPLC 1000 can operate up to 32 Profisafe devices.
 

Simultaneous execution of different communication paths

Although the computational intensity is decreasing in a distributed application, it is becoming increasingly important to manage additional communication paths. This is the main reason why the SPLC 1000 supports Profisafe. The SPLC can simultaneously assume both the role of Profisafe controller (F-Host) and F-Device.
 

Simpler programming with one unified engineering tool

Due to the small width of 45 mm for the SPLC 1000, in combination with the AXC F 2152 you have a full-fledged safety control system only 90 mm wide. Moreover, the whole is fully programmable with one programming package PLCnext Engineer. Code for the AXC F 2152 can be programmed both in IEC 61131-3 and in a higher programming language. In addition, we use the same tool to also build the safety software from standard safety blocks or in Safe-C. The safety and control software are in one project.

Siemens SIPLUS
The availability of machines and plants is a basic requirement for productivity. In order to minimize unplanned downtimes, it is necessary to detect the sources of error at an early stage. This is exactly where SIPLUS CMS Condition Monitoring Systems come in: they continuously monitor the condition of mechanical components of your machines – even throughout the entire plant. SIPLUS CMS therefore represents an important step toward the digital factory, where all the players including machines, products and people along the value chain will be networked. SIPLUS CMS working together with MindSphere – the cloud-based, open IoT operating system from Siemens – opens up completely new possibilities. The powerful cloud platform is designed for analyzing large quantities of data and enables machine parks all over the world to be monitored for service purposes in order to reduce their downtimes.

Phoenix Contact Axioline
The modular station communicates with a PROFINET controller, e.g., a distributed control system, via a bus coupler. As an option, up to eight PROFIBUS PA segments can be connected to the individual proxy outlets in a compact way. To ensure the individual segments are immune to interference, appropriate shield connection technology is available.

Siemens SENTRON 3KD
SENTRON 3KD load switches and 3KF fuse switch disconnectors provide reliable personal safety and ensure a high level of system availability in industry, infrastructure and buildings. The latest 3KD and 3KF versions can be used for a wide range of applications and have innovative functionality for reporting problems and statuses. In order to eliminate risks, the SENTRON 3KD and 3KF meet all the necessary requirements of a main, emergency stop or isolating switch.
